U.S. fast food chain Subway opened its first restaurant outside Bucharest last week and the second in Romania, in Iulius Mall shopping center in Cluj-Napoca, owned by Iulius Group.The restaurant was opened Saturday in an area of 80 square meters, located on the second floor of the mall, according to Iulius Group. Subway in Cluj-Napoca is the first restaurant opened in the partnership with Iulius Group,the second location will be inaugurated on May 31, 2012, in Iasi, in Palas Mall. The company opened nearly a month ago the first restaurant in Romania, in Victoria Square in Bucharest, and concerns over the next four years to launch 40 units on the Romanian market.
